
Stewart-Haas Racing is an American stock car racing team currently competing in the NASCAR Cup Series and the NASCAR Xfinity Series. The team was first established in 2002 and was then known as Haas CNC. In 2009, three-time NASCAR Cup Series champion Tony Stewart joined as a driver and co-owner.
The same year, the team claimed its first NASCAR Cup Series win at Pocono Raceway. Since then, Stewart-Haas has secured three drivers' championships and over 100 race wins across competitions. The team has fielded notable drivers such as Kevin Harvick, Kurt Busch, and Danica Patrick. The team’s manufacturer is Ford and the team’s operations are based in Kannapolis, North Carolina, located near Charlotte Motor Speedway.
Stewart-Haas Racing Owner
Stewart-Haas Racing is co-owned by Tony Stewart and Gene Haas, two influential figures in the world of motorsports. Stewart is a three-time NASCAR Cup Series champion, and Haas is a successful businessman. The team was founded as Haas CNC in 2002 and Stewart joined as a co-owner seven years later.

Tony Stewart
Tony Stewart, often referred to as "Smoke," was born on May 20, 1971, in Columbus, Indiana. He began his racing career at a young age, quickly racing across various disciplines. He switched to NASCAR in 1999. Over his 17-year career in the NASCAR Cup Series, he secured three championships (2002, 2005, and 2011) and achieved 49 wins.
In 2009, Stewart became co-owner of Stewart-Haas Racing alongside Gene Haas and played a dual role as driver and owner. Beyond his accomplishments in NASCAR, Stewart has also excelled in other racing formats. He has won championships in IndyCar and various dirt track series. Besides Stewart-Haas, he has also founded Tony Stewart Racing, which competes in sprint car racing.
Gene Haas
Gene Haas founded Haas Automation in 1983, which has grown to become one of the largest builders of CNC machine tools in North America. Born in Ohio, he moved to Los Angeles with his family during his youth. There, Haas worked various jobs, including delivering newspapers and working in machine shops, where he developed a knowledge of machining. He graduated from California State University in 1975 with a degree in accounting and finance. He switched to business due to concerns about job stability in the engineering field. In 1983, Haas founded Haas Automation and the rest is history.
Haas entered NASCAR in 2002 with his team. After a few years, he entered into a partnership with Tony Stewart and together they formed the Stewart-Haas racing. In addition to motorsports, Haas is involved in Formula One through his ownership of the Haas F1 Team.
Stewart-Haas Racing Owners Net Worth
Tony Stewart has an estimated net worth of $90 million while Gene Haas is worth around $250 Million, as per Celebrity net worth. Stewart’s wealth is credited to his successful career as a race car driver, with him earning approximately $130 million in prize money alone. In addition to his driving career, Stewart has diversified his income through various business ventures, including ownership stakes in multiple racing teams and the Eldora Speedway.
Gene Haas is the founder of Haas Automation, built one of the largest CNC machine tool manufacturers in North America. Further, he owns teams across NASCAR and Formula One greatly contributing to his net worth of a quarter of a billion dollars.
